Audrey & Adam’s Virginia Beach backyard wedding was a dream!

Let me tell you a little bit about Audrey & Adam because I just love these two. I actually first met Audrey when she was a 9th grader at Ocean Lakes! She’s so amazing and ambitious, and I’ve enjoyed catching up with her and getting to know Adam, too.

They have the sweetest love story. They met in February 2012 after they were recruited for the UVA track team. Throughout that spring, they kept in touch, sending mix CDs (aw!!) and getting together at track meets. Adam surprised Audrey by asking her out on their first date… Ocean Lakes prom! Before prom, they took photos in Audrey’s backyard where six years later, to the day, I got to take their wedding photos. Isn’t that the best??

There’s something so intimate and special about a backyard wedding. The waterfront home was gorgeous and had the most beautiful flowers everywhere you turned. There were hydrangeas for days! The wedding had a lot of beautiful and fun details, too. The floral wedding arch was such a lovely frame for their ceremony, and there was a great surprise Chipotle grooms cake.  Adam’s reaction seeing the cake was awesome.  Oh, and all the different color bridesmaid dresses looked incredible.  I loved seeing a few familiar faces during the reception, so many OL grads who are now all grown up and doing amazing things.  

I had the best time shooting Audrey & Adam’s day. Congratulations!!
